Endobronchial lesion in an adolescent with hemoptysis biopsy or not to biopsy?

Manoj Madhusudan et al.

Summary: An 11-year-old girl presented with recurrent massive hemoptysis. Imaging studies revealed ground glass opacities and hypertrophied right pulmonary artery. Bronchoscopy and endobronchial ultrasound confirmed the diagnosis of bronchial Dieulafoy disease. Bronchial angiography showed a vascular malformation, which was successfully treated.
